Asset Location Tab

 

The Asset Location tab allows the user to specify the location of the asset. It contains information on where the asset will be located, whether on-campus or off-campus. To enter a location, you must provide the asset status and asset type code.

      The asset status is used to specify whether the asset is capital or non-capital. The asset type code identifies the asset category.

      The Asset Type Code table has a required building indicator and a movable indicator.

 

The asset status in conjunction with the asset type code determines what location information is required.

 

For example, capital movable equipment requires a valid campus, building, and room combination or an off-campus address. Non-capital assets require only a campus code.

 

Asset Location tab field definitions

Title

Description

Building Code

Enter the code designated to the building in which the asset is/will be physically located or search for the code from the Building lookup icon.

Building Room Number

Enter the building's room number in which the asset is/will be physically located or search for the number from the Room lookup icon.

Building Sub Room Number

Enter the code created for departmental use. Most departments use this field to enter the cubicle sub-room number.

Campus

Required. Enter the code identifying the physical campus in which the asset is/will be physically located or search for the code from the Campus lookup icon.

(Off Campus) Address

Enter the off-campus street address where the asset is/will be located or stored.

(Off Campus) City

Enter the off campus city where the asset is/will be located or stored.

(Off Campus) Country

Select the country from the Country list or search for it from the Country lookup icon.

(Off Campus) Name

Enter the name of the person in charge of the asset at the off-campus location.

(Off Campus) Postal Code

Enter the postal code or search for it from the Postal Code lookup icon.

(Off Campus) State

Enter the state or search for it from the State lookup icon. The state code is validated against the State table. The state code is not required if the asset is outside the US.
